Rochdale train station is well-equipped to cater to your needs. With a ticket office open from early morning till late night, purchasing or collecting your pre-booked tickets is hassle-free. Ticket machines are available and accessible, accepting both cash and cards. For those who prefer using smartcards, the station supports issuing and validating them.
Step-free access is provided across the station, making it scooter and wheelchair friendly. While accessible toilets are not available, regular toilet facilities ensure basic needs are met. Though there aren't dedicated waiting rooms, the station offers ample seating for those waiting for their train's arrival.
Convenient transport links make Rochdale station a hub of connectivity. If your journey includes rail replacement services, be assured of a smooth transition with pick-up and drop-off at the Network Rail Parking Bay right outside the station. For taxi services, Northern Railway’s Cab4You service is at your disposal.
Buses to Bury and Bolton are readily accessible on Maclure Road, with the busline service reachable at 0871 200 2233. Although there's no bike hire directly at the station, an extensive public transport system ensures that Rochdale is well connected via GMPTE with queries at 0161 228 7811.

Chapel-en-le-Frith station operates without a traditional ticket office, but offers ticket machines for easy purchase and collection of your travel documents. It is notable that smartcards can be issued here, although there are no validators on site. There's no step-free access to all platforms, and some routes involve ramp and foot crossing use. While there are ramp aids available for train access, be prepared for a rustic experience as the station lacks modern luxuries like Wi-Fi, refreshment facilities, ATMs, and waiting rooms. The seating provided does offer a simple solution for those waiting for their train, but ensure to plan ahead when it comes to your travel comforts.
Accessibility is a mixed bag here. While some areas do provide step-free access, be ready for uneven ground in certain parts, especially if you're crossing platforms. The station is categorized as scooter friendly, and assistance can be requested using customer help points. However, be advised that there's no dedicated staff assistance, so plan accordingly if additional help is required. For those with mobility challenges, finding a taxi might be a better option, and information on available services can be accessed through local rail and station websites.
Chapel-en-le-Frith station offers essential connections through local transport services. Comprehensive rail replacement buses operate regularly, with buses to Buxton leaving from the opposite side of Trike Guy Store, and services towards Manchester departing near the New Inn. Although bicycles can be stored using provided stands, there is no cycle hire available at the station. Those needing taxi services can turn to platforms like Cab4You for booking information.
